Step to Transfer Norton Antivirus to Another Computer

  • Download and install the Norton product on the new computer.
  • Log in to your Norton account.
  • Select the product you want to transfer to the new computer.
  • On the new computer, open the Norton Security window and select the activation option.
  • Enter the activation code from your Norton account.
  •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the transfer process.
  • Once the transfer is complete, you should be able to access the same protection you had on the old computer on the new computer.
